Yankees' Offensive Drought Continues: Three Games, Zero Runs – A Concerning Trend?
The New York Yankees are facing a crisis. Not a pitching crisis, not an injury crisis (although those certainly contribute to the overall narrative), but a full-blown offensive drought. Three games. Zero runs. That’s the stark reality facing the Bronx Bombers, leaving fans and analysts alike questioning whether this slump is a temporary blip or a sign of deeper problems. The silence at Yankee Stadium is deafening, replaced only by the groans of a frustrated fanbase.
This scoreless streak isn't just a statistical anomaly; it represents a significant shift in the team's performance. For a franchise historically known for its powerful bats and prolific run production, this prolonged offensive struggle is deeply concerning. The lack of timely hits, the inability to string together rallies, and the overall lack of aggression at the plate are all major causes for concern.
The Heart of the Problem: A Breakdown of the Offensive Struggles
Several factors contribute to the Yankees' current offensive woes. One key issue is the lack of consistent production from the heart of the order. While Aaron Judge continues to be a threat, the supporting cast hasn't stepped up, leaving too much pressure on their star player. This over-reliance on one player is a recipe for disaster, as evidenced by the current scoreless streak.
Another factor is the team's struggles against quality pitching. Facing elite arms exposes the weaknesses in the Yankees' approach at the plate. Their inability to adjust to different pitching styles and make necessary changes to their hitting strategy has resulted in numerous strikeouts and weak contact.
- Lack of timely hitting: The Yankees are leaving runners on base at an alarming rate. This inability to capitalize on scoring opportunities is a significant contributor to their current predicament.
- Struggles against quality pitching: Elite pitchers are exploiting weaknesses in the Yankees' approach, leading to frustrating at-bats.
- Lack of consistent production from the lineup: Too much pressure is resting on a few key players, and the supporting cast hasn't delivered.
